5.3.8 Set the Engine ID of a Local or Remote Device
You can use the following commands to set the engine ID of a local or remote device.
Perform the following configuration in system view.
Table 5-9 Set the engine ID of a local or remote device
Set the engine ID of the device
Restore the default engine ID of the
device.
By default, the engine ID is expressed as enterprise No. + device information. The
device information can be IP address, MAC address, or user-defined text.
